The Indian Culinary Delights in Winter
For no season of marriage is an Indian wedding without good and elaborate food arrangements, and winters surely add up to the spread— it allows a more decadent, more indulgent menu of hearty dishes and warm beverages. Think of traditional delights like gajar ka halwa — a sweet carrot dessert that everybody loves during winter, or hot jalebis and gulab jamuns drizzling with syrup; Shahi Tukda or Mysore Pak, the appetites of the Nawabs.
Equally inviting will be the savoury side, with rich, creamy curries, tandoori delicacies, and a spiced kebab or two. For cold hands to be warmed up—excellent and toasty from a night of dancing under the stars—think of a full bar with mulled wine, spiced teas, and hot chocolate.

Winter Wedding Attire: Infusion of Traditional and Glamorous Elements
Winter weddings in India are simply an amazing excuse to mix the traditional attires with unique styles. One can wear velvet lehengas or saris with deep, rich, embroidered hues. After all, they are going to keep the bride warm anyway and reflect the regal look that she puts on.
Grooms can even get into the feel of the season by sporting rich fabrics—velvety brocades or silk sherwanis—coupled with a matching warm shawl or stole.
